基于Jsp+servlet+mysql的酒店订单管理系统源码分析
152 浏览量
更新于2024-12-15
收藏 2.43MB ZIP 举报
本系统的主要功能包括用户界面设计、订单创建、订单查询、订单更新、订单删除以及订单统计分析等。系统后端使用Java作为开发语言,通过Servlet处理业务逻辑,同时利用JSP作为展示层,将处理结果以动态网页的形式展现给用户。数据库选用MySQL,负责存储所有相关的数据,包括客房信息、客户信息、订单信息等。整个系统的设计旨在提供高效、稳定、易于使用的订单管理服务,满足酒店业务需求,提高工作效率,减少人力物力资源的浪费。此外,系统还包括了一个完整的毕业设计论文,详细描述了系统的设计和实现过程,为理解系统架构和开发细节提供了书面指导。"
知识点详细说明:
1. 系统架构:酒店订单管理系统采用B/S(Browser/Server)架构,这种架构的优势在于用户无需安装额外软件,通过浏览器即可访问系统,便于系统的部署与维护。系统分为三个主要层次:表现层、业务逻辑层和数据访问层。
2. JSP技术:JSP是一种动态网页技术,它允许开发者将Java代码嵌入到HTML页面中。当客户端请求一个JSP页面时,服务器先将JSP页面转换成Servlet代码,然后执行并返回生成的HTML给客户端浏览器。JSP是实现表现层逻辑的主要技术。
3. Servlet技术:Servlet是运行在服务器端的小型Java程序,它能够处理客户端请求并生成响应。在本系统中,Servlet用于处理来自客户端的业务请求,执行后台逻辑如订单管理、数据处理等,并将结果返回给JSP页面进行显示。
4. MySQL数据库:MySQL是一个流行的开源关系型数据库管理系统,它用来存储系统的结构化数据。在酒店订单管理系统中,MySQL负责存储客房信息、客户信息、订单详情等数据,确保数据的安全和完整性。
5. 订单管理功能:系统的订单管理功能包括创建订单、查询订单、更新订单和删除订单。这些功能允许酒店员工快速高效地处理客户订单,提高服务质量,同时也为管理人员提供了订单统计分析功能,以便于更好地理解酒店业务运行情况。
6. Java后台开发:系统后端采用Java语言开发,Java因其跨平台、面向对象、安全性高等特性被广泛用于企业级应用的开发。Java后台负责实现业务逻辑、与数据库交互以及封装数据处理等功能。
7. 毕业设计论文:毕业设计论文部分详细记录了酒店订单管理系统的设计与开发过程,包括需求分析、系统设计、技术选型、功能实现和测试等部分。论文是理解系统设计意图和实现方法的重要文档,对于学习和了解整个系统开发流程具有重要的指导意义。
8. 系统测试与维护:虽然在文件名称列表中没有明确提及,但系统测试与维护是实际工作中不可或缺的一部分。系统测试包括单元测试、集成测试和性能测试等,确保系统的稳定性与可靠性。而系统维护则是指在系统上线后,对系统进行定期的更新和问题修复,以保证系统长期稳定运行。
343 浏览量
764 浏览量
874 浏览量
131 浏览量
195 浏览量
141 浏览量
213 浏览量
198 浏览量
152 浏览量
芝麻粒儿
- 粉丝: 6w+
最新资源
- 易语言实现URL进度下载的源码示例
- JDK1.8版本详解:适合高版本软件的Java环境配置
- Ruby版Simple Code Casts项目部署与运行指南
- 大漠插件C#封装技术详解与应用
- 易语言实现Base64编解码的汇编源码解读
- Proyecto KIO网络中间件getContact深入解析
- 微软PowerShell自定义学习项目介绍
- ExtJS 3.3中文教程:前端开发指南
- Go语言在VR领域的新突破:集成OVR Linux SDK
- Python Kivy实现的Google服务客户端入门指南
- 微软Visual C++ 2008 Express版下载发布
- MATLAB开发实现球形投影数字化工具
- 掌握JavaScript实现待办事项清单应用
- inmarketify项目:TypeScript应用实践指南
- 俪影2005 v1.28:图像编辑与文件夹加密软件
- 基于MD5骨骼动画在Direct3D中的实现与核心算法解析